Netanyahu's Future On The Line In Israeli Parliamentary Election

JERUSALEM (AP) —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u's political survival was on the line Tuesday in a hard-fought parliamentary election pitting his nationalist and security-first ideology against his challengers' focus on the plight of the country's struggling middle class.

Opinion polls showed a tight race heading into Tuesday's vote, with Netanyahu's opponents, led by Isaac Herzog of the centrist Zionist Union, showing a slight lead. The last available poll was published Friday, when a significant number of voters were still undecided.

In a dramatic last-ditch effort to appeal to his right-wing base, Netanyahu reiterated his pledge Tuesday to prevent the establishment of a Palestinian state and took a swipe at Israel's own Arab minority.

"Right wing rule is in danger. Arab voters are going to the polls in droves. Left wing organizations are bringing them in buses," Netanyahu said in a video statement posted on his Facebook page.
